How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Lift Repair Engineer Jobs in Luton at Stannah - Join Our Team!

    Salary Up to £63,000 (incl OTE) based on skills and experience level.

    Are you a skilled Lift Engineer ready to take the next step in your career? This is your opportunity to join Stannah, a globally recognised, family-run business at the forefront of the lift industry.

    We’re looking for a talented Repair Engineer to cover Luton and surrounding areas, carrying out minor refurbishment works across a diverse range of passenger lifts, vertical access lifts, and moving walkways from multiple manufacturers. In this role, you’ll deliver high-quality repair and refurbishment services while supporting business objectives and ensuring exceptional service delivery standards are met. Your work will play a vital role in maintaining safety, reliability, and customer satisfaction across a varied portfolio of equipment, making every day both challenging and rewarding.

    The role reports into the Brackley Service Branch, where you’ll be part of a supportive and well-established team.

    Your be joining a business that combines strong family values with global reach, where your skills are valued and your career can grow. If you're a qualified Lift Repair Engineer looking for a fresh challenge in a forward-thinking company, we want to hear from you.

    Working Hours: Monday to Thursday 8am till 16:45 and Friday 8:00 till 15:45

    Lift Repair Engineer Responsibilities:

    You will be responsible for carrying out Minor repairs on a wide range of lifts across our portfolio.

    Ensure high-quality service and safety standards.

    Perform effective risk assessments and maintain site log cards.

    Support the training of apprentices and trainee engineers ,using your experience to bring through the next generation of engineers .

    Please see the full job description here: 

    Qualifications
    Lift Repair Engineer Requirements:

    An NVQ level 3 in Lift Engineering or equivalent.

    Proven experience as a Lift Engineer and minor repairs

    A valid UK driving licence.

    Benefits Include:

    Competitive Salary, paid on a monthly basis

    Profit Share Bonus Scheme, paid to all employees every quarter. Based on Group Company profits

    25 days holiday, plus bank holidays

    Holiday scheme to buy extra days’ annual leave

    Pension Scheme. Matched contribution/salary sacrifice

    SimplyHealth Cash Plan. Allows you to claim towards health costs. For example, dental, optical, physiotherapy, chiropody treatments and more

    Life Assurance Scheme

    Long Service award scheme, with holiday benefit

    Company Benefits Discount Rewards Scheme. Includes shop discounts, hotel discounts, days out, and more

    Employee Assistance Programme. A workplace initiative to support and enhance well-being

    Enhanced maternity and paternity provision

    Free parking

    Company Van
